How much do senior software engineering manager j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 17, 2026, the average yearly pay for senior software engineering manager in Missouri is $166,016.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$142,100.00 and $186,700.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How does a Senior Software Engineering Manager typically balance technical leadership with team management responsibilities?

A Senior Software Engineering Manager often splits their time between providing technical guidance and overseeing team development. This means staying involved in high-level architecture decisions while also focusing on mentoring engineers, conducting performance reviews, and facilitating communication across teams. Balancing these aspects requires strong organizational skills, as managers must ensure project delivery timelines are met without sacrificing team morale or individual growth. Regular one-on-ones, sprint planning sessions, and collaboration with product managers are key parts of the weekly routine.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Senior Software Engineering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Senior Software Engineering Manager, you need a solid background in software development, strong leadership abilities, and experience managing engineering teams, often sup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with project management tools (like Jira), cloud platforms (such as AWS or Azure), and agile methodologies is typically expected, and certifications like PMP or Scrum Master can be advantageous. Outstanding communication, strategic thinking, and mentorship skills help build high-performing teams and foster collaboration. These skills and qualities are crucial for delivering successful projects, supporting team growth, and aligning technical work with business objectives.

What is a Senior Software Engineering Manager?

A Senior Software Engineering Manager is a leadership role responsible for overseeing multiple software engineering teams or large projects within an organization. They manage engineering managers and senior engineers, define technical strategies, and ensure the successful delivery of complex software solutions. In addition to technical oversight, they are involved in talent development, process improvement, and cross-functional collaboration with other departments. Their role is crucial for aligning engineering goals with business objectives and fostering a culture of innovation and excellence.

The St Louis Fed is one of 12 Reserve Banks serving all or parts of Missouri, Illinois, Indiana, Kentucky, Tennessee, Mississippi, and Arkansas with branches in Little Rock, Louisville and Memphis. The St. Louis Fed's most critical functions include promoting stable prices and economic growth, fostering a sound financial system, providing payment services to financial institutions, supporting the U.S. Treasury's financial operations, and advancing economic education, community development and fair access to credit.
